使用netlify反向代理到家庭IPv6服务
背景
- 家庭宽带只有IPV6公网地址, 但是没有IpV4公网地址
- 已经利用了DDNS-GO, 完成了自己域名和IPV6地址的动态绑定. 具体介绍见 https://github.com/jeessy2/ddns-go
以上, 我们已经可以自己的域名在IpV6下访问到家里的服务器了, 但是在只有ipv4地址的情况下, 我们无法访问到家里的服务器. 虽然说ipv6已经推广很多年了,但是很多家庭/公司为了求稳/网络设备没升级, 还是ipv4为主, 所以ipv6的普及度还是不够高.
那么在这样的网络环境内, 我们如何访问到家里的服务器呢?
找到了这样一个文章, https://notes.dsdog.tk/archives/1718719529754 使用netlify反代加速. 大概步骤如下:
- 创建一个github项目, 创建_redirects文件, 内容描述把请求转发到自己的域名上
- 部署
- 绑定自己的另外一个域名, 方便记忆和访问
总结
- netlify是大善人, verlcel、cloudfare一样 都是;
- 没有什么是加一个中间层解决不了的,如果有,那就再加一个中间层.